Transaction 742616383421b7e67fcc750668d43d111f5bb756d990654036dd67727535b908
1 Input
1 Output
-
742616383421b7e67fcc750668d43d111f5bb756d990654036dd67727535b908:0
- value
- 10089602
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4eca78f9692636d0554d48365b933ff8ed40eea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LQqkiNqaB9jcycD7z15H4fhcT2PXjWhQj